Transaction 60e65596df13187445eda39dee69fb9e916bfb94c318c131aeadf36154fc9557
1 Input
1 Output
-
60e65596df13187445eda39dee69fb9e916bfb94c318c131aeadf36154fc9557:0
- value
- 2000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 56f288251aefe6759594003e9e89082296da3227d78dc459dfbb6bb0c11d0192
- address
- bc1p2megsfg6aln8t9v5qqlfazggy2td5v3867xugkwlhd4mpsgaqxfqkp4eec